### Changed defaults — Tolling pricing experiment (v2.8.0)

The Farequill ticket-pricing experiment now defaults to the bounded-bandit allocator instead of uniform split. For the security reviewer: this change means experiment assignments are derived from a salted hash rather than the raw account identifier, and audit logging of bucket decisions is on by default. Rollback to the old behavior requires an explicit override and leaves an audit trail. The new default configuration shipped with this release reads as follows:

settings of fafog-haduf:
ZORIX_PIN=4648
ZORIX_METRICS_HOST=metrics.zorix.paliqsys.corp
ZORIX_LOG_LEVEL=info
ZORIX_TENANT=druix

Onboarding note for security reviewers at Vantreska. The read-replica lag alarm fires when replication delay on the Corbelline cluster exceeds ninety seconds; alerts route through the paging tier and are logged immutably for audit. Reviewers should confirm alarm configs are signed before approving changes. All alarm configuration bundles are verified against the signing key below.

deploy key for kajof-fajop: bky6_gDHw9Q

Subject: New "Orbit Plus" Tier — Heads Up

Hi all,

Quick update for department heads: we're launching the Orbit Plus subscription tier next quarter, sitting between Standard and Enterprise. It bundles priority support, the analytics pack, and early feature access. Pricing lands mid-range, and marketing kicks off after the Veltham conference. One strategic detail stays within this group for now.

management briefing: Project Ulavan slips by two quarters because of the staffing delay.